MMairyOur stay in this hotel was great! I wish we stayed here longer than one evening.
Our traditional Japanese room was very spacious and had two separate toilet rooms attached as well as a bathroom. The view from our room was amazing! And sitting area before the huge windows even had a massage chair and a vanity. The shoji doors showed some signs of wear but everything were very clean.
Our kaiseki dinner was spectacular and incredibly tasty. But I wish there were some instructions for foreigners how to enjoy it properly. Our server didn't speak English and we didn't speak Japanese so there was a minor misunderstanding but everything was resolved 😅
I'm definitely a fan of such kind of a meal now!
We visited all the hot springs that are available in this hotel and it's sister hotel across the river. I liked the silver indoor spring in our hotel and gold outdoor spring in sister-hotel the most. Hot springs are closed after 24:00. And open from 6:00 to 9:00 nest morning. Unfortunately they are closed from 9:00 to 12:00(check out time) which make it impossible to enjoy them in the morning for those who prefer to sleep in((
Would definitely reccommend the stay for relaxing and luxurious experience.

GGuest UserThe main purpose of this trip is to come here to soak in the hot springs. I stayed here for 3 days and felt very good.
The small town of Arima is full of bathing hotels. When walking around Arima town, it seems that there are not many Chinese tourists, and most of them are Japanese tourists on weekends. The hotel where I stayed was very quiet because children were not welcome and children under 12 years old were not allowed to stay.
In particular, I would like to talk about the service of this hotel.
The first is the catering. They will make various adjustments to your three-day meal. Although they are all set meals, they will make different combinations of various ingredients. The only drawback is that the dinner is too large.
Let's talk about the service. It should be first-class. When you walk into the hotel, someone will take the initiative to take your luggage. When you check in, your luggage has been sent to the guest room. When you arrive at the front desk, After verifying your identity, a service lady will take you to the guest room, and then carefully introduce you to various service facilities and everything you need to know.
The hotel's cleaning is also very unique. Daily cleaning is carried out by a service lady who leads all the cleaning staff. The cleaning staff have their own division of labor. They clean the floor, make the beds, tidy the bathroom, and organize tea sets and food. It is operated by different people to ensure that people doing hygiene will not touch the tea sets and food.
Let’s also talk about the language. Although there are no Chinese-speaking staff in the hotel, with the translation software and the staff’s serious and enthusiastic service attitude, there is no obstacle.
The biggest emotion is that there are not many people here during the Spring Festival, so I really enjoy it
